Picture Dial - Dial Friends & More Using Pictures

In an interesting twist from their PictureID application Toysoft has released Picture Dial. It is essentially a customizable speed-dial application based on pictures. It lets you dial a contact, send an SMS/email, or browse a website just by clicking pictures. There does seem to be a trial available and you can pick it up for a $5.95 at this link.

Product description:

Dial contact, send SMS and browse website using picture ids.  No need to remember phone numbers again or what the person looks like.  Just snap the picture with the camera application or use any GIF, PNG or JPG picture and use it in Picture Dial. Not only can you dial contacts but you can also send SMS, Email and browse contact website. 

Features:

  • Supports Small and Large picture ids
  • Supports PNG, GIF and JPG pictures
  • Supports Internal and SD card  memory
  • Supports Contact lookup when creating new Picture Dials
  • Import Contacts
  • Send SMS and Email
  • Browse contact website
  • Edit and crop picture
  • Custom color for contact labeling
  • Very easy to use

Note: Assign PictureDial to the left or right side  convenience button for quick access.  Go to the Options application and select Screen/Keyboard to assign it.
